Navigating the Tech Job Market: A Guide Inspired by TechSearch Services
To effectively position yourself in the tech job market, it's crucial to identify the skills that employers are actively seeking. Data from industry reports and job postings indicate several key areas of expertise that remain consistently in demand: 1. **Software Development**: Proficiency in programming languages such as Python, Java, and JavaScript is essential. Software engineers are in high demand to develop and maintain applications that enhance business operations. For instance, a report from the Bureau of Labor Statistics (BLS) projects a 22% growth rate for software development jobs over the next decade, making it a robust career choice. 2. **Data Analysis**: Companies are increasingly leveraging data for strategic decision-making, resulting in a surge of roles focused on data analysis. Skills in SQL, R, and data visualization tools like Tableau can significantly enhance a candidate's marketability. For example, a data analyst role at a Fortune 500 company may require proficiency in SQL to manage large datasets, highlighting the importance of this skill. 3. **Project Management**: As tech projects grow in complexity, effective project managers are necessary to ensure that teams meet deadlines and operate within budget constraints. Familiarity with Agile methodologies and tools like Jira can set candidates apart. According to the Project Management Institute, employers are expected to need 25 million new project management professionals by 2030. 4. **Cybersecurity**: With the rise in cyber threats, the demand for cybersecurity professionals has skyrocketed. Key qualifications include knowledge of network security, ethical hacking, and compliance standards. The Cybersecurity & Infrastructure Security Agency (CISA) reports a critical need for skilled cybersecurity personnel, with job openings projected to increase significantly in the coming years. By honing skills in these areas, job seekers can align their professional development with current market demands, enhancing their employability.
Crafting a Tailored Resume
With a clear understanding of the high-demand skills, the next step is to create an impactful resume that effectively showcases your qualifications. Here are several strategies to consider: 1. **Customize for Each Application**: Tailor your resume to each position by incorporating relevant keywords from the job description. This not only improves the appeal of your resume but also increases its chances of passing through Applicant Tracking Systems (ATS) that many companies use to filter applicants. 2. **Highlight Achievements**: Rather than merely listing job responsibilities, focus on quantifiable achievements. For example, stating “Increased website traffic by 30% over six months” or “Led a team of five in developing a software solution that reduced processing time by 20%” provides tangible evidence of your impact. 3. **Include Soft Skills**: While technical skills are crucial, soft skills such as communication, teamwork, and problem-solving are equally valued in the tech industry. Provide examples of how you demonstrated these skills in past experiences, such as collaborating on a team project or resolving a conflict. 4. **Professional Development**: Mention relevant certifications, courses, or workshops that showcase your commitment to ongoing learning. For instance, certifications from platforms like Coursera or Udacity can indicate your initiative to expand your knowledge.
The Importance of Networking
Beyond a strong resume and relevant skills, networking is a critical component of securing a job in the tech industry. Here are some effective strategies to expand your professional network: 1. **Attend Industry Events**: Engage in tech conferences, workshops, and meetups to connect with industry professionals. Such events provide valuable opportunities to learn from experts and build relationships that could lead to job referrals. 2. **Leverage LinkedIn**: Use LinkedIn to highlight your skills and experiences. Connect with professionals in your field, engage with their content, and participate in discussions to enhance your visibility. A well-optimized LinkedIn profile can serve as a powerful tool for job seekers. 3. **Informational Interviews**: Reach out to individuals in roles you aspire to and request informational interviews. This initiative not only helps you gather insights about the industry but also expands your network organically, potentially leading to job opportunities. 4. **Join Professional Organizations**: Becoming a member of relevant professional associations can provide access to resources, job boards, and networking opportunities that are invaluable for career advancement.
TechSearch Services: A Profile
TechSearch Services has established itself as a premier recruitment firm specializing in the technology sector. With a commitment to connecting top talent with innovative companies, TechSearch Services offers a range of products and services aimed at enhancing the recruitment process. Their offerings include: - **Talent Acquisition**: TechSearch Services employs advanced techniques to identify and attract the best candidates, utilizing data-driven methodologies to match candidates with the right roles. - **Consulting Services**: The firm provides consulting services to tech companies, helping them refine their recruitment strategies and improve their hiring processes. - **Career Coaching**: TechSearch Services also offers career coaching for job seekers, providing guidance on resume building, interview preparation, and personal branding. ### Locations of TechSearch Services TechSearch Services operates from various strategic locations across the United States, including major tech hubs such as San Francisco, New York, Austin, and Seattle. Each office is staffed with experienced recruitment professionals who understand the local job market and can provide tailored support to both candidates and employers.
Navigating the tech job market may seem overwhelming, but with the right approach and resources, you can significantly improve your chances of success. By focusing on high-demand skills, crafting a tailored resume, and actively engaging in networking, you can position yourself as a strong candidate in this competitive field. This guide, inspired by the practices of TechSearch Services, aims to empower job seekers with the knowledge and tools necessary to thrive in the fast-evolving world of technology. Remember, persistence and adaptability are key; with determination and the right strategies, you can achieve your career aspirations in the tech industry.
Front-End Web Developer
Large tech companies like Google, Facebook, and Amazon, as well as startups and digital agencies.
Core Responsibilities
Design and implement user interfaces for web applications using HTML, CSS, and JavaScript frameworks (e.g., React, Angular).
Optimize web applications for maximum speed and scalability, ensuring a seamless user experience across various devices.
Collaborate with UX/UI designers to translate design prototypes into functional web pages.
Required Skills
Proficiency in responsive design principles and front-end performance optimization.
Familiarity with version control systems like Git and agile development methodologies.
Experience with accessibility standards and best practices.
Data Scientist (Machine Learning Focus)
Tech giants like Microsoft and IBM, as well as financial institutions and healthcare companies.
Core Responsibilities
Develop and implement machine learning models to extract insights from complex datasets and drive business decisions.
Conduct exploratory data analysis to identify trends and patterns, and present findings to stakeholders.
Collaborate with cross-functional teams to define data requirements and support product development.
Required Skills
Strong programming skills in Python or R, with experience in libraries such as TensorFlow and Scikit-learn.
A solid foundation in statistics and experience with data visualization tools (e.g., Tableau, Matplotlib).
Understanding of data preprocessing techniques and model evaluation metrics.
Cybersecurity Analyst
Security firms, financial institutions, and government agencies.
Core Responsibilities
Monitor network traffic for suspicious activity and respond to security incidents in real time.
Conduct vulnerability assessments and penetration testing to identify and mitigate security risks.
Develop and implement security policies and procedures to protect sensitive data and comply with industry regulations.
Required Skills
Knowledge of network protocols, firewalls, and intrusion detection systems (IDS).
Familiarity with security frameworks (e.g., NIST, ISO 27001) and tools like Wireshark and Metasploit.
Certifications such as CompTIA Security+, Certified Ethical Hacker (CEH), or Certified Information Systems Security Professional (CISSP) can be advantageous.
Cloud Solutions Architect
Enterprise-level companies, cloud service providers, and startups focusing on cloud technology.
Core Responsibilities
Design and implement cloud-based solutions tailored to meet the unique needs of the organization or clients.
Assess existing systems and recommend migration strategies to transition to cloud platforms (e.g., AWS, Azure, Google Cloud).
Collaborate with development teams to ensure cloud architecture aligns with application requirements and security standards.
Required Skills
Proficiency in cloud services and architectures, including serverless computing and microservices.
Understanding of networking, database management, and security best practices in cloud environments.
Relevant certifications from cloud providers (e.g., AWS Certified Solutions Architect, Google Cloud Professional Cloud Architect).
Agile Project Manager
Tech startups, software development firms, and companies undergoing digital transformation initiatives.
Core Responsibilities
Facilitate agile ceremonies (e.g., sprint planning, daily stand-ups, retrospectives) to ensure effective team collaboration and project progress.
Serve as the primary point of contact for stakeholders, communicating project status and managing expectations.
Identify and mitigate risks, ensuring that the project stays on track and within budget.
Required Skills
Experience with agile methodologies (Scrum, Kanban) and tools (e.g., Jira, Trello).
Strong leadership and communication skills, with the ability to guide cross-functional teams.
Relevant certifications such as Certified ScrumMaster (CSM) or Project Management Professional (PMP).